- Ioannis Stefanou receives an ERC Consolidator Grant for his INJECT projectJanuary 31, 2023Preventing human-induced seismicity to fight against climate change is the main thrust of the INJECT project selected in the ERC Consolidator Grant call and led by Professor Ioannis Stefanou at Centrale Nantes and the Research Institute in Civil and Mechanical Engineering (GeM).

- Our new Bachelor of Science in Engineering is now accreditedJanuary 10, 2023Centrale Nantes is expanding its international education offer with the creation of a new Bachelor of Science (BSc) in Engineering. With a first intake in September 2023, the programme is designed for international students and will be taught in English on its Nantes campus. The three-year BSc programme is now accredited by the CTI (Commission des Titres d’Ingénieur) and students that obtain this degree will be awarded a national bachelor level certificate.
